About This Book
Discover the fascinating world of sand and learn about its many shapes, colors, and places it can be found. Young readers will explore how sand is made and all the different ways it is used every day. Perfect for early readers curious about nature and the world around them!

Why we rated Sand (Rookie Readers) 5C
Sand (Rookie Readers) is written at a Level K-1 reading level across 31 pages (approximately 99 words). Strong independent readers around grade 1.9 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, Sand (Rookie Readers) works for readers up to grade 2.9.
Read aloud, Sand (Rookie Readers) takes about 1 minutes, which fits within a single read-aloud session.
We rate Sand (Rookie Readers) as 5C ("Clear") because the content sits in the "Gentle" range — no conflict beyond everyday childhood experiences.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ly gentle; no single dimension stands out as a concern.
No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the gentle intensity score.
